The Vitality™ 5-0 PGA (Polyglycolic Acid) Violet Suture is a FDA-approved, braided absorbable suture. This formulation ensures dependable tensile strength, excellent handling, and smooth passage through delicate oral tissue.
Designed for implant surgeries, soft tissue repair, and guided bone regeneration (GBR), this suture maintains strength for 14 to 21 days and is fully absorbed in approximately 50 to 90 days. Its 30-inch thread length provides more working length than typical sutures, reducing waste and improving efficiency. The 3/8 reverse-cutting needle (16 mm) ensures clean, accurate placement with minimal trauma.

## How long does the Vitality™ 5-0 PGA Suture retain strength?
Vitality™ 5-0 PGA Suture retains approximately 50–70% of its strength at 14 days, with complete loss of tensile support by 21 days. It is fully absorbed in 6–13 weeks, depending on patient healing.
## Is this suture suitable for guided bone regeneration?
Vitality™ 5-0 PGA Suture is commonly used in GBR and grafting procedures where short-term support is needed without triggering a strong inflammatory response.
